The hotel is a bit of a walk from Sukhothai Historical Park, but still within reasonable distance. Given that the sidewalks aren't in the best condition, taking a Grab might be more comfortable. This is a small, family-run hotel, which contributes to its very friendly atmosphere, and the staff speak English. They offer bike rentals, though at 180cm tall, I found them a bit small. Our room was clean, and the shower and toilet worked without any issues. While the hotel doesn't serve meals, there are several local eateries nearby. Plus, the gas station next door has a convenience store if you need to grab some simple food items.

Pleasant stay at an old style wooden house, with a kind owner who will try to accommodate you. If you’re sensitive with the slightest sound then this is not suitable for you. Simple breakfast is provided every morning to start your day off. The place also provides free bicycle rental to roam around the Old City. Just a stone throw away from 7-eleven (with ATMs) and the daily night market surrounding the lake where you can have picnic dinner by it. If you’re coming using Wintour Bus, it will drop you off less than a 100m from this stay (provided that your end destination is the Old City Sukhothai, as the Sukhothai Bus Terminal is located in the new city) & you can also buy tickets there to go to your next destination. There are also other bus companies’ kiosks / stores along the street that you can check them out.

Toon was an excellent launching point for exploring the Sukhothai temples, as the guesthouse is located right in front of the main entrance to the historical park. In addition to this, both bike and golf cart rental options are available at adjacent shops. In terms of service, it's pretty good - the owner lives in one of the rooms and is usually on-site, though they do disappear now and then to live their life. Check-in and check-out both rely on trust; when the owner is out they make arrangements so check-in can be done without them. In terms of amenities, the room had a good amount of space and soap, toilet paper, and a desk were included, as well as two bottles of water (but these were not refreshed on subsequent days). The facility also offers a free toast (bread/jam available) and coffee/hot chocolate breakfast in the morning to get some cheap calories in before your day exploring. Rooms don't contain a fridge, but there is one located in the main area of the second floor (though this wasn't mentioned when checking in to my first floor room, I found it myself later). Shower pressure/heat was pretty good, and AC proved sufficient once it got going, despite the apparent age of the unit. The bed was firm, but not hard, and corridor noise was pretty low. Overall, I'd say Toon is EXCELLENT value for visiting Sukhothai's old town, and a much better spot to start from than anything in the new town unless you really think you're going to want to do much of anything in the late evening after a full day of exploring temples!
